Moving from Omaha, NE, to Spring Valley, NV, runs anywhere from $845 for a DIY rental-truck move of a small home up to $9,016 for full-service movers handling a larger 4 - 5 bedroom household. The two cities sit about 1,291 miles apart, and a move on this route usually takes 3 to 8 days door to door. Use our moving cost calculator to compare estimates and options for your specific move.

There are 3 main ways to move from Omaha to Spring Valley: full-service movers, moving containers, and rental trucks. Full-service is the most expensive but covers everything from labor to transportation, with a 2-3 bedroom move on this route averaging $3,041 - $6,592. Containers cost roughly 30% less than full-service for the same home size, and rental trucks run about 60% less, though loading is on you with either DIY option. At 1,291 miles, expect 3 to 8 days in transit no matter which service you choose.

Here is how full-service movers, moving containers, rental trucks, and freight trailers compare on the 1,291-mile route from Omaha to Spring Valley, broken down by home size:

Home size Full-service movers Moving container Rental truck Freight trailer
Studio / 1 bedroom $2,410 - $5,524 $1,277 - $2,575 $845 - $1,564 $1,245 - $2,273
2 - 3 bedrooms $3,041 - $6,592 $1,646 - $3,347 $905 - $1,995 $1,344 - $2,929
4+ bedrooms $4,874 - $9,016 $2,466 - $4,397 $1,160 - $2,271 $1,916 - $3,592

Full-service moving costs from Omaha, NE to Spring Valley, NV

Hiring full-service movers from Omaha, Nebraska, to Spring Valley, Nevada, costs between $2,410 and $9,016. A full-service interstate moving company handles loading, transportation, and unloading across the 1,291-mile route, with optional professional packing available for an additional $297 - $1,980, depending on the size of your home. Your final cost comes down to two things: the total weight of your shipment and the distance between Omaha and Spring Valley. For a rough baseline, movers based in Omaha tend to start around $154 plus $106/hour per mover on local jobs, before long-distance pricing takes over for a move this size.

Here's a breakdown of full-service moving costs by home size from Omaha to Spring Valley: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$2,410 - $5,524
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$3,041 - $6,592
  • 4+ bedrooms: $4,874 - $9,016

Good to know: For moves over 500 miles, national movers are consistently lower-priced than local companies in Omaha, NE. Van lines spread long-haul costs across multiple shipments, while local movers tend to charge 30% - 40% more for the same distance. A direct route with a local mover averages 2-day delivery, but that added speed typically carries a higher price tag.

Moving container costs from Omaha, NE to Spring Valley, NV

Moving containers from Omaha, Nebraska, to Spring Valley, Nevada, cost between $1,277 and $4,397. The container gets dropped at your door and you load it at your own pace. U-Haul gives you 3 days to load and PODS gives you up to 30. Once you're done, the company handles all the transportation. If you need extra time, storage in Omaha runs about $70/month.

Take a look at moving container pricing by home size from Omaha to Spring Valley: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,277 - $2,575
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$1,646 - $3,347
  • 4+ bedrooms: $2,466 - $4,397

What other costs come with moving containers?

  • Storage: Monthly rental charges begin after the first 30 days. Expect roughly $74 per month for smaller containers (7 - 8 feet) and around $149 per month for larger units (12 - 16 feet).
  • Moving labor: Containers don't come with loading help, so many customers hire hourly movers for the job. Two movers for about 5 hours will run you around $693 in Omaha, NE, per moveBuddha data. Compare the best labor-only movers nationwide
  • Added contents protection: Standard coverage only reimburses by weight. Full-value protection gives you more complete coverage for higher-value items and typically costs 1% - 2% of your total declared value, around $500 - $1,000 on a $50,000 shipment.
  • Access: National providers generally operate in both cities, but verify that a facility near your Spring Valley, NV, destination exists if you plan to access stored items.

Moving truck rental costs from Omaha, NE to Spring Valley, NV

Plan on $845 - $2,271 for a rental moving truck on the 1,291-mile route from Omaha, Nebraska, to Spring Valley, Nevada. The rental company provides nothing beyond the vehicle, so add:

  • Fuel for the drive: $407 - $465
  • Daily insurance: $30/day
  • Equipment rentals: $7 - $20
  • Omaha daily rental rate: $19 - $39
  • Per-mile fee beyond your free allowance: $0.79 - $0.99
Home sizeTypical truck size
Studio / 1 bedroom10 - 12 ft
2 - 3 bedrooms15 - 17 ft
4+ bedrooms20 - 26 ft (typically requires diesel)

These are typical moving truck rental costs from Omaha to Spring Valley based on home size: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$845 - $1,564
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$905 - $1,995
  • 4+ bedrooms: $1,160 - $2,271

Pro tip: The advertised base rate of $845 - $2,271 does not include fuel ($407 - $465) , lodging ($149/night for overnight stops), meals, or equipment rentals. When you add those up, the true cost of your move from Omaha to Spring Valley typically runs $600 - $1,200 more than the base rate alone.

What other costs come with rental trucks?

  • Additional insurance: Supplemental coverage typically averages around $30 per day.
  • Lodging: Budget around $149 per night if your drive requires an overnight stop. Typically, you'll make 1 - 3 overnight stops, depending on move distance.
  • Moving labor: Bringing in professional loading help in Omaha, Nebraska, usually costs about $693 for 2 movers and 5 hours of labor.
  • Gas: Fuel for the 1,291-mile drive falls between $407 and $465, depending on whether your truck runs on gas or diesel.
  • Equipment: Appliance dollies, moving pads, and vehicle trailers are easy to overlook but can add between $50 and $297 to your total.

Freight trailer costs from Omaha, NE to Spring Valley, NV

Freight trailers are a solid option for larger DIY moves from Omaha, Nebraska, to Spring Valley, Nevada. Standard trailers run 28 feet long, and you're only charged for the portion you actually fill. The carrier drops the trailer off, you load it at your own pace, and they handle the drive to your new city.

Pricing is based entirely on the linear footage your shipment occupies, not the full trailer length. Most long-distance freight moves land somewhere between $891 and $2,929.

Take a look at freight trailer costs based on home size for moves from Omaha to Spring Valley: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,245 - $2,273
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$1,344 - $2,929
  • 4+ bedrooms: $1,916 - $3,592

Pro tip: Loading a freight trailer is a bit different from filling a container. The 4-foot ramp can be steep with large items, and getting the most out of 8 feet of vertical clearance takes planning. Since pricing is based on linear feet used, every inch of wasted space has a cost.

What other costs come with freight trailers?

  • Seasonal demand: Pricing tends to rise during peak moving season, particularly between mid-May and mid-September.
  • Moving labor: Most customers hire loading help since freight is self-loaded. Two movers in Omaha, Nebraska, for roughly 5 hours typically costs $693.
  • More space: Freight companies bill by linear footage. If your belongings take up more room than anticipated, the extra space adds between $74 and $149 per foot.

Pro tip: If speed matters on your move from Omaha to Spring Valley, freight trailers are one of the fastest interstate options available, second only to renting a truck and driving it yourself. The tradeoff is that freight works best when you're ready to receive your belongings on the other end. If your timeline is tight on the receiving side or you need a short storage buffer, a moving container might be a better fit.

How do I know a mover is licensed in Nevada?

Movers that provide relocation services within the Silver State are subject to rules and regulations set forth by the Nevada Transportation Authority (NTA). The NTA’s aims include fostering economic growth and promoting efficient, safe, and reliable moving services around the state.

What is the best time of year to move from Omaha, NE to Spring Valley, NV?

Aim for a move between October and March, when demand drops and rates tend to be lower across all service types. Peak season runs mid-May through mid-September, and weekends and month-end dates are pricier regardless of season. A midweek, mid-month date outside peak season is your best bet for saving money.

What size moving truck do I need for this route?

Rental trucks generally range from 10 to 26 feet. A 15- to 17-foot truck covers most 2-bedroom moves, while a smaller 10- to 12-foot truck works for a studio or 1-bedroom. Homes with 3 or more bedrooms usually need a 20- to 26-foot truck, and anything that size typically runs on diesel rather than gas.
